1. Begin the conversation about college.
- Do you know what you want to study?
- How far away from home do you want to be?
- Big school or small school?
- Is it affordable for my family and I?
2. Take rigorous classes!
- Colleges like to see that you have challenged yourself
- Take as many AP/Honors courses that you can handle
3. Get involved!!!
- Find extra curricular activities that you enjoy (i.e. sports, Honors Society, working, choir, etc.)
- Have a diverse range of activities that you are involved in
- Become a leader in those clubs
4. Get a folder or notebook that you can keep a list of your extra curricular activities in, as well as any rewards or recognitions you get over the next 4 years.
